Hello All,
ent to do a water change in the QT/Frag tank today. Found the damsel hiding under the egg crate and had a large white spot over its left eye. The eye looks a bit enlarged. The damsel is not doing well, a lot of leaning to one side heavily and struggling to stat static. Have had it for about 5 weeks.

Any thoughts on ID?

It could be an injury that became infected, is the fish in a QT or do you have frags in there? You can start by treating with an antibiotic if there are no frags. Metroplex, kanaplex, furan-2 are all ones I would recommend. If you don't have a QT without corals then you can feed the kanaplex in food bound with seachem focus.

I'm currently using the tank as both a QT and frag tank and it is the only fish, but have three frags in there with it. I have both focus and kanaplex on hand.
 
It could be an injury. The pictures are too blurry to see much. You can feed the kanaplex + focus, that's fine. Using a frag tank with corals as a QT isn't really all that helpful since you can't treat for much with the corals present and the corals can bring in fish diseases too. Just an fyi :)

I ended up setting up a make shift 5 gallon bucket with HOB filter for treatment. Treated with Kanaplex directly. Will perform a water change tomorrow (48 hours) and retreat. He is still eating! Thanks for all the help. I need to get my FO QT up and running sooner rather than later it seems.
